Remco Evenepoel blew away the competition on Saturday in the time trial of the Volta ao Algarve. Of course, this required good legs in the first place, but the winner was also very pleased with the material. His monster resistance was particularly striking. The leader of Soudal Quick-Step had a front chain with no less than 62 teeth, he told afterwards. The last news.

“We have adjusted the bicycle position a little this winter and the mechanics and the performance team have also figured out all kinds of things, in terms of shifting and all kinds of other things,” says Evenepoel, who has sat a little lower and ‘slightly more compact’. “I think we have just taken a serious step forward in all areas.”

As far as this ‘resistance’ was concerned, Evenepoel said that he rode with a 62 front wheel in the time trial of the Volta ao Algarve. “We made that choice because of the course – it went downhill a lot. I thought it was a limit myself. Our good friend Victor Campenaerts started this, we ‘stole’ it from him. It went very well. I can only be satisfied with the work of the entire team.”
